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is also a wintry month in Buttonwoods, Rhode Island, with temperature in the range of an average low of 25°F (-3.9°C) and an average high of 37.9°F (3.3°C).

Temperature

At the start of February, Buttonwoods's average high-temperature reaches a still wintry 37.9°F (3.3°C), subtly different from the preceding month. The average low-temperature during February nights is a subzero cold 25°F (-3.9°C).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in February in Buttonwoods is 77%.

Rainfall

In Buttonwoods, in February, during 9.2 rainfall days, 2.13" (54m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 150.8 rainfall days, and 28.66" (728m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through April, November and December are months with snowfall in Buttonwoods. February is the month with the most snowfall. Snow falls for 6.2 days and accumulates 2.56" (65mm) of snow.

Daylight

In February, the average length of the day in Buttonwoods is 10h and 38min.
On the first day of February, sunrise is at 6:57 am and sunset at 5:00 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:20 am and sunset at 5:35 pm EST.

Sunshine

February has the least sunshine of the year in Buttonwoods, with an average of 4.8h of sunshine.

UV index

January through March,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index in Buttonwoods, Rhode Island. A UV Index reading of 2, and below, represents a minimal health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.

Average temperature in February
Buttonwoods, RI

Average temperature in February - Buttonwoods, RI
  • Average high temperature in February: 37.9°F

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is July (80.4°F).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(35.2°F).

  • Average low temperature in February: 25°F

The month with the highest average low temperature is July (65.5°F).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(24.3°F).
